Extreme weather warning over snow
Roads could be plagued by snow at the start of the week
The first snowflakes have begun to fall over eastern England - as forecasters warn of the heaviest and most widespread snowfall for six years.
East Anglia, Lincolnshire and the Midlands are already experiencing fairly heavy snow showers.
Kent, London, Surrey and Hampshire will see up to 15cm of snow overnight, with much of England and Wales set to be severely affected by Monday.
Severe disruption is expected to roads and airports, with the M2 hit first.

The Met Office is warning of severe weather for much of the country over the coming days, in what is expected to become the heaviest snowfall since January 2003.
